how often do the computers fail in our cars? Do aftermarket tuners like the Apex'i AFC affect the computer in negative ways? Has anyone fried there ECU by using a tuning device?
 
slider85 said:
how often do the computers fail in our cars?
Do aftermarket tuners like the Apex'i AFC affect the computer in negative ways?
Has anyone fried there ECU by using a tuning device?

Unfortunatly, just about all of them will over time because of a poor choice in capacitor selection back when the ECUs were designed. They also have problems because the engineers didn't decide to add protection from shorted outputs and things like the ISC sometimes die shorted.

A correctly installed SAFC shouldn't impact the ECU in a negative way. There is still some question about doing the "blue wire mod" for reading the o2 sensor casuing the O2 output to read lower due to circuit loading.

I sure a few people have from improper installs.
